Learn more at https://www.jnj.com/medtech We are searching for the best talent for Material Handler. Purpose: Coordinates the receipt and dispatch of the materials, components, parts and pieces required for the process of assembly and manufacturing according to production schedule and manufacturing priorities. Supply the components and materials required to the different work stations so that operators can perform your work. Ensures control and integrity of inventory levels of materials used in manufacturing processes. Adheres to environmental policy, procedures, and supports department environmental objectives.

Responsibilities

  • Receives and stores materials following Good Manufacturing Practices to ensure integrity in the product.
  • Prevents mixes of components and facilitates the delivery and handling of the raw material, office supplies and materials to be used in the workstations.
  • Receives lots of products from Manufacturing according to the work plan.
  • Segregates and distributes the lots according to FIFO and/or established priorities.
  • Dispatches the raw material, office supplies and materials to each area.
  • Maintains inventory levels of the raw material and of the "processing supplies" required in manufacturing according to the Kanban system established by area.
  • Transports materials from one department to another manually or by using haul equipment.
  • Performs material count, as required by the "Cycle Count" program.
  • Generates reports in SAP or others to identify discrepancies.
  • Participates and executes corrective actions as required.
  • Is responsible for ensuring that the established "Cycle Count" metrics are met.
  • Prepares requisition of materials using established forms as STD. (Stock Transfer Document), etc.
  • Coordinates the acquisition of materials and equipment with the Buyer.
  • Prepares and submits material inventory adjustments through "Material Inventory Transaction" (MIT's).
